Detailed specifications

General parameters such as number of shaders, GPU core base clock and boost clock speeds, manufacturing process, texturing and calculation speed. Note that power consumption of some graphics cards can well exceed their nominal TDP, especially when overclocked.

Pipelines / CUDA cores896240
Core clock speed1485 MHz500 MHz
Boost clock speed1665 MHzno data
Number of transistors4,700 million372 million
Manufacturing process technology12 nm45 nm
Power consumption (TDP)75 Watt133 Watt
Texture fill rate93.248.000
Floating-point processing power2.984 TFLOPS0.24 TFLOPS
ROPs328
TMUs5616
L1 Cache896 KBno data
L2 Cache1024 KBno data

VRAM capacity and type

Parameters of VRAM installed: its type, size, bus, clock and resulting bandwidth. Integrated GPUs have no dedicated video RAM and use a shared part of system RAM.

Memory typeGDDR5GDDR3
Maximum RAM amount4 GB512 MB
Memory bus width128 Bit128 Bit
Memory clock speed2000 MHz700 MHz
Memory bandwidth128.0 GB/s22.4 GB/s
